To compile the program that creates the material files for MC-GPU
(MC-GPU_create_material_data) you need to add penelope.f to the compilation
line:
"g77 -O MC-GPU_create_material_data.f penelope.f -o MC-GPU_create_material_data.x"
Then, when you run the executable file it will ask for all the information that
is required to generate the file.
The program uses linear interpolation and therefore it is good to use a large
number of bins (look the example files).
To generate a particular material, you will need the corresponding material
file generated with the material.f program from PENELOPE 2006 (this is how the
"pendbase" database is indirectly used).
